MARIAM IS ONLY FIFTEEN WHEN SHE IS SENT TO KABUL TO MARRY RASHEED. NEARLY TWO DECADES LATER, A FRIENDSHIP GROWS BETWEEN MARIAM AND A LOCAL TEENAGER, LAILA, AS STRONG AS THE TIES BETWEEN MOTHER AND DAUGHTER. WHEN THE TALIBAN TAKE OVER, LIFE BECOMES A DESPERATE STRUGGLE AGAINST STARVATION, BRUTALITY AND FEAR. YET LOVE CAN MOVE A PERSON TO ACT IN UNEXPECTED WAYS, AND LEAD THEM TO OVERCOME THE MOST DAUNTING OBSTACLES WITH A STARTLING HEROISM.
